日志管理策略是一种用于管理组织或系统中日志数据的规划和方法。它涉及到如何收集、存储、分析和利用日志信息,以满足合规性要求、支持故障排查、提供数据分析和保障安全等目的。 在现代信息技术环境中,日志数据通常由各种系统、应用程序、网络设备和安全工具生成。这些日志包含了关于系统活动、用户行为、错误和异常等重要信息。通过有效的日志管理策略,可以更好地利用这些数据,从而: 1. 满足法规遵从性:许多行业和法规要求组织记录和保留特定类型的日志,以证明合规性。 2. 故障排查和问题诊断:通过分析日志,可以追踪和解决系统故障、性能问题和安全事件。 3. 监测和安全审计:日志可以帮助检测异常活动、识别潜在的安全威胁,并支持安全审计和调查。 4. 数据分析和趋势洞察:对日志数据的分析可以提供有关系统运行状况、用户行为模式和业务趋势的见解。 一个良好的日志管理策略应该包括以下方面: 1. 日志收集:确定需要收集的日志源,并制定适当的收集方法,如使用日志代理、中央日志收集器或日志传输协议。 2. 日志存储:选择合适的存储介质和架构,以确保日志的安全性、可访问性和持久性。 3. 日志保留:确定日志的保留期限,根据法规和业务需求制定合理的保留政策。 4. 日志分析:采用合适的工具和技术,对日志进行实时或定期分析,以提取有价值的信息。 5. 安全和访问控制:确保日志的完整性和保密性,设置适当的访问控制,限制对日志的未授权访问。 6. 警报和通知:配置警报机制,以便在关键事件或异常发生时及时通知相关人员。 7. 审计和审查:建立定期的审计和审查流程,以确保日志管理策略的有效性和合规性。 此外,日志管理策略还应考虑到日志的备份、恢复和灾难恢复等方面,以确保在意外情况下日志数据的可恢复性。 总之,日志管理策略的目标是通过有效地管理和利用日志数据,提高系统的可靠性、安全性和运营效率。它是组织信息技术管理的重要组成部分。
制定有效的日志管理策略需要综合考虑多个因素,并遵循一些关键步骤: 1. **明确目标和需求**:首先,确定日志管理的目标,例如合规性、故障排查、安全监测等。了解组织的具体需求,以便为策略制定提供方向。 2. **评估现有基础设施**:审查现有的日志生成和存储系统,包括服务器、网络设备、应用程序等。确定是否需要更新或添加新的日志收集工具。 3. **定义日志范围**:确定需要收集哪些类型的日志,如系统日志、应用程序日志、安全日志等。明确日志的来源和格式,以便进行统一管理。 4. **建立日志收集和存储机制**:选择合适的日志收集工具和存储解决方案。考虑使用集中式的日志管理系统,以便有效地收集、存储和分析日志。 5. **设置日志保留政策**:根据法规要求和业务需求,确定日志的保留期限。过长的保留期可能导致存储成本增加,而过短的保留期可能无法满足审查和分析的需要。 6. **定义分析和监测方法**:确定如何分析和监测日志数据,例如使用日志分析工具进行实时监控、设置警报规则等。建立相应的流程和指标,以确保及时发现和解决问题。 7. **实施安全和访问控制**:确保日志的安全性,限制对日志的访问权限。实施访问控制措施,防止未授权的访问和篡改。 8. **制定应急计划**:考虑到可能发生的数据丢失或系统故障,制定相应的应急计划,包括日志的备份和恢复策略。 9. **培训和沟通**:对相关人员进行培训,使他们了解日志管理策略的重要性和如何有效地使用日志。建立有效的沟通机制,确保团队成员之间能够及时共享信息。 10. **定期审查和更新**:定期审查日志管理策略,根据组织的变化和新的需求进行更新。持续改进策略,以适应不断变化的环境。 在制定日志管理策略时,还需要注意以下几点: 1. 与相关部门和团队合作,确保各方的需求和意见得到充分考虑。 2. 遵循法规和行业标准,确保策略的合法性和合规性。 3. 测试和验证日志管理系统,确保其有效性和可靠性。 4. 建立清晰的文档和指南,以便团队成员能够准确理解和执行策略。 通过认真制定和实施有效的日志管理策略,组织可以更好地管理和利用日志数据,提高系统的可靠性、安全性和运营效率。
日志管理策略在安全领域有多个重要的应用,以下是一些常见的例子: 1. **入侵检测和预防**:通过分析日志,可以监测系统中的异常活动和潜在的入侵行为。实时的日志分析可以帮助及时发现并阻止安全攻击。 2. **合规性审计**:许多行业都有法规要求,需要记录和保留特定的安全相关日志。日志管理策略确保组织能够满足这些合规性要求,并提供必要的审计线索。 3. **事件调查**:在发生安全事件或违规行为时,日志可以作为重要的证据来源。通过审查日志,安全团队可以追踪事件的源头、确定影响范围,并采取相应的措施。 4. **用户行为分析**:分析用户的登录活动、操作记录等日志信息,可以发现潜在的内部威胁、异常行为或未授权的访问。 5. **漏洞管理**:日志可以帮助识别系统中的漏洞利用尝试、错误配置或其他安全问题。及时的日志分析有助于及时修补漏洞,提高系统的安全性。 6. **威胁情报收集**:收集和分析来自多个来源的日志数据,可以获取有关新兴威胁和攻击模式的情报。这有助于组织提前采取防御措施。 7. **安全监控和预警**:设置警报规则和监控指标,通过日志分析可以实时监测安全状况,并在发生异常时及时发出警报。 8. **数据泄露检测**:观察日志中的数据传输和访问活动,有助于检测数据泄露的迹象,并采取措施保护敏感信息。 9. **身份和访问管理**:结合身份验证和授权系统的日志,可以审查用户的访问权限和操作,确保合规性,并发现潜在的权限滥用。 10. **安全性能评估**:分析日志可以评估安全系统的性能,包括检测率、误报率等指标,为安全策略的优化提供依据。 在实际应用中,日志管理策略可以与安全信息和事件管理(SIEM)系统、入侵检测系统(IDS)、防火墙等安全工具和技术结合使用,以增强安全监测和响应能力。同时,定期的安全审计和日志审查也是确保日志管理策略有效实施的重要环节。 通过合理的日志管理策略,组织可以更好地检测和应对安全威胁,保护其信息资产的安全。然而,要注意的是,日志管理不仅仅是技术问题,还需要建立良好的安全文化和培训员工,以确保日志的准确性和完整性。此外,保护日志的安全性同样重要,防止日志被篡改或删除,以免影响安全分析和调查。